Air Fryer Tofu Recipe

Ingredients

  • 1 block firm tofu
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h herbs for garnish (optional)

Servings and Cooking Time

This recipe serves 2 and takes approximately 15 minutes of preparation time and 15 minutes of cooking time.

Step-by-Step Cooking Process

  1. Press the tofu for 15 minutes to remove excess moisture.
  2. Cut the pressed tofu into bite-sized cubes.
  3. In a bowl, combine soy sauce, olive oil,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per.
  4. Add tofu cubes to the bowl and gently toss to coat.
  5. Sprinkle cornstarch over the marinated tofu and mix until evenly coated.
  6.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(200°C).
  7. Place the tofu cubes in the air fryer basket in a single layer.
  8. Cook for 12-15 minutes, shaking halfway through for even cooking.
  9. Once golden and crispy, remove from the air fryer and let cool slightly.
  10. Garnish with fresh herbs before serving.

Alternative Ingredients

If you’re looking for alternatives, you can use tamari instead of soy sauce for a gluten-free option. Additionally, try using arrowroot powder instead of cornstarch for a different texture.

Serving and Pairings

This crispy tofu pairs wonderfully with rice or quinoa bowls, salads, or as a topping for stir-fries. It also complements dipping sauces like sweet chili or peanut sauce for extra flavor.

Storage and Reheating

Store leftover tofu in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at in the air fryer for a few minutes to regain its crispy texture. While freezing is possible, it may alter the texture once thawed.

Cooking Mistakes

  • Not pressing the tofu enough can lead to sogginess.
  • Overcrowding the air fryer basket prevents even cooking.
  • Skipping the cornstarch can result in less crispiness.
  • Using too much marinade can make the tofu soggy.
  • Not shaking the basket halfway through may lead to uneven cooking.

Helpful Tips

  • Use extra-firm tofu for the best texture.
  • Experiment with different spices to customize flavors.
  • Let the tofu marinate for at least 30 minutes for more flavor.
  • For added crunch, try a coating of panko breadcrumbs.
  • Always preheat your air fryer for optimal results.

FAQs

Can I use soft tofu for this recipe?

Soft tofu is not recommended as it will not hold its shape and will likely become mushy in the air fryer. Stick to firm or extra-firm tofu for best results.

How do I ensure my tofu is crispy?

Pressing the tofu to remove excess moisture and coating it with cornstarch are essential steps to achieve a crispy texture. Ensure your air fryer is preheated as well.

Can I make this recipe 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the tofu and marinate it ahead of time. However, it’s best to cook it fresh for the crispiest results.

What can I serve with air fryer tofu?

Air fryer tofu is versatile! Serve it over rice, in salads, or with your favorite dipping sauces. It also works well in wraps and grain bowls.

Is this recipe vegan-friendly?

Absolutely! This air fryer tofu recipe is entirely plant-based and a great source of protein for vegans and vegetarians alike.
